Guests that stayed at this property said

The majority of guests found the property to be spotlessly clean and tidy, with only a few isolated comments about garden upkeep and minor cleaning oversights.

The property's location is highly praised for its quiet setting and short walk to the beach and town, although some noted the walk involves steep hills which may not suit everyone.

Guests generally found the house comfortable, with good-sized bedrooms and comfortable sofas, though some found the beds hard and the early morning light an issue in the bedrooms.

Facilities were deemed adequate, but several guests reported issues with the TV and other minor maintenance problems. The lack of Wi-Fi in some cases and the need for better kitchen equipment were also mentioned.

Many guests were delighted by the thoughtful welcome packs and fresh flowers, which contributed positively to their experience. However, it should be noted that such gestures are not guaranteed for every stay.

About this property

Howards Hill West, a mid-terrace cottage, sits delightfully in the popular Norfolk seaside town of Cromer, just a short stroll from its wonderful Blue Flag beach. It comes within conveniently close proximity of the countryside, coastline and attractions of the region, making it an ideal stay for families and friends looking to explore the area. Enter this neutrally decorated cottage and head left into the welcoming sitting room, a warming spot to kick back and relax after exploring the stunning Norfolk Coast AONB. Step through into a modern kitchen/diner, well-equipped and furnished delightfully, while adjacent to this is a peaceful lean-to porch with a cosy armchair, an ideal spot to sit and read a book or enjoy your morning coffee. The first floor of Howards Hill West plays host to two comforting bedrooms; a double which has beautiful sea views out of the window, and a twin bedroom are served by a fresh family bathroom offering a shower over the bath. To relax outside, step out into the back garden where you can enjoy a refreshing drink with the sea breeze to accompany you. A short stroll will lead you into this charming seaside town, it boasts a wealth of charming amenities along with its renowned clifftop pier and wonderful sandy beach to make the most of. The whole of beautiful Norfolk beckons from here, you can easily explore the astounding Norfolk Coast AONB, the countryside of the Norfolk Broads and the wonderful city that is Norwich. For an alternative day at the beach, head to the ever-popular resort of Great Yarmouth, offering much for the visitor to see and do. Explore the fabulous area of Norfolk from this homely terraced cottage.

The seaside town of Cromer is on the Norfolk coast and is known for its clifftop promenade with its gardens and views. Cromer has a Blue Flag beach, a Victorian pier offering theatre shows, a museum and an rnli lifeboat station and a variety of shops, cafés, restaurants, pubs and amusements. To truly experience Norfolk, explore the Norfolk Coast aonb, the Norfolk Broads and the stunning city of Norwich.

Accommodation

Two bedrooms: 1 x double, 1 x twin (zip/link, can be double on request).

Bathroom with a basin, first floor cloakroom with a basin and WC.

Kitchen/diner.

Sitting room.

Electrical heating.

Electric oven and hob, fridge, freezer, washing machine, Smart TV with freeview, WiFi.

Fuel and power included in rent.

Bed linen and towels included in rent.

Highchair available.

Off-road parking for one car.

Enclosed rear lawn and patio garden with furniture.

Sorry, no pets and no smoking.

Shop and pub 10-minute walk.
